Abstract
An electrolyzer model for the analysis of a hydrogen production system using a solid oxide electrolysis cell has been developed, and the effects of principal parameters have been estimated via sensitivity studies based on the developed model. The main parameters considered were current density, area-specific resistance, temperature, pressure, molar fraction, and flow rates in the inlet and outlet. A simple model is also estimated for a high-temperature hydrogen production system that integrates the solid oxide electrolysis cell with a very high temperature reactor.
